James has 195.84 square yards of land he can use to grow vegetables. He wants to divide this into patches of 16.32 square yards.

He will be able to create garden patches on his land. If he wants to create garden patches with an area of 32.64 square yards, he will be able to create patches on the land.

Answer:

With 16.32 square yards, James gets 12 patches.

With 32.64 square yards, he gets 6 patches.

Step-by-step explanation:

James has 195.84 square yards of land he can use to grow vegetables.

He wants to divide this into patches of 16.32 square yards.

So, he will get \frac{195.84}{16.32}=12 equal patches.

If he wants to create garden patches with an area of 32.64 square yards, then he gets \frac{195.84}{32.64}=6 patches.

Question:

Jackson buys a grape snow cone on a hot day. By the time he eats all the "snow" off the top, the paper cone is filled with 27\pi27π27, pi cm^3 3 start superscript, 3, end superscript of melted purple liquid. The radius of the cone is 333 cm. What is the height of the cone?

Answer:

The height of the cone is 9 \ cm

Explanation:

It is given that the radius of the cone is 3 \ cm

The volume of the cone is 27\pi

The height of the cone can be determine using the formula,  

$V=\frac{1}{3} \pi r^{2} h$

Substituting the values V=27 \pi and r=3, we get,

$27 \pi=\frac{1}{3} \pi(3)^{2} h$

Multiplying both sides by 3, we have,

$81 \pi= 9\pi h$

Dividing both sides by $9 \pi$, we have,

9=h

Thus, the height of the cone is 9 \ cm
